Coconut Chia Breakfast Parfait with American Harvest Chia Seeds

Start your morning with this creamy, layered Coconut Chia Breakfast Parfait — a no-cook recipe packed with omega-3s, fibre, and natural energy. Made with American Harvest premium chia seeds and coconut milk, it takes just 5 minutes to prep the night before.

Ingredients

  • 3 tbsp American Harvest Chia Seeds
  • 200ml full-fat coconut milk (or your preferred plant milk)
  • 1 tbsp honey or maple syrup
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• Fresh mango, sliced
  • Fresh berries (strawberries, blueberries)
  • 2 tbsp toasted coconut flakes
  • Granola, to layer

Instructions

  1. Mix the chia pudding: In a jar or bowl, whisk together American Harvest Chia Seeds, coconut milk, honey,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  2. Refrigerate overnight: Cover and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ight. The chia seeds will absorb the liquid and form a thick, creamy pudding.
  3. Layer your parfait: In a serving glass, layer granola, then the chia pudding, then fresh mango and berries. Repeat for a second layer.
  4. Top and serve: Finish with toasted coconut flakes, a drizzle of honey, and a few extra berries. Serve chilled.

Nutrition Tips

  • High in fibre: Chia seeds support digestive health and keep you feeling full until lunch.
  • Rich in omega-3: Important for heart health and brain function.
  • Naturally gluten-free: A great option for those with gluten sensitivities.

Variations

Try swapping coconut milk for almond or oat milk. Add a layer of American Harvest Peanut Butter for extra protein, or replace fresh fruit with dried dates and figs for a GCC-inspired twist. This parfait works equally well as a midday snack or light dessert.

Prep & Storage

Prep time: 5 minutes | Chill time: 4+ hours | Serves: 2

Store assembled parfaits (without granola topping) in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Add granola just before serving to keep it crunchy.
